D.1. Conjunctions

Example:
He ate rich food and lay in bed all day.
We can break this sentence into two sentences.
1. He ate rich food.
2 He lay in bed all day.

We use ‘and’ to join two or more words or group of words. We also use ‘but’, ‘when’, ‘because’ and ‘Or’ to join two or more words or group of words.

The Boy Who Lost His Appetite Summary In English

Sham was a rich young man. His father had passed away very early. After his father’s death, he became the owner of all his father had. Now, he started living a luxurious life. He ate rich food and lay in bed all day. As a result, he  became very lazy and lost his appetite and didn’t find any foo tasty

Once, he went to hunt in woods. He was not used to ride fast so he lagged behind his friends and got lost. After six to seven hours of roaming he felt tired and hungry. He reached to a peasant’s hut and asked for some food. The poor peasant gave him dal, rod which he found very tasty to eat. The peasant guided him the right way. Back to home he got back to his rich food and lazy ways. Again he found his rich food tasteless. He wondered why the simple dal-roti tasted so nice.
